ESC *
Print graphic information
[Code]
[1Bh] 2Ah] + m + n1 + n2 + D1+...+Dk
m (0, 1, 20h or 21h)
0 <= ? n 1 <= ? F F
0 <= ? n 2 <= 01
Di (i from 1 to k)
The number of horizontal dots is n1+n2*256.
The number of data bytes k is n1 + 256*n2 for mode 0 and 1 and (n1 + 256*n2) for
20h and 21h.
The units in each data byte correspond to black dots.
Data is sent in vertical columns downward and from left to right, 1 or 3 bytes in a
column depending on the selected mode.
